Former Embakasi West MP George Theuri plots 2027 comeback

Former Embakasi West Member of Parliament George Theuri is a man on a mission. Theuri, who served as Embakasi West MP for 10 years has kick started his re election bid ahead of the upcoming 2027 general elections.
In various social media posts, Theuri went out to call on his supporters to stay calm as he has been re-stategizing for a grand comeback noting that everything comes to you at the right time.
I call on you to be patient and trust the process. I shall be back and I will bounce back in 2027, so just be patient” Theuri said.
While noting that he has learnt from his failures in the 2022 elections when he was ousted by the current Mark Mwenje, the seasoned legislator said that the time for suffering does not last long and he is going to bounce back much better.
“Mateso ni kwa muda tuu; jikazeni tu.  Aluta contunua. My blunder at the last election was a learning experience and I have corrected where we went wrong. This is our countdown to  2027,” Theuri said.

In 2013, Theuri became the first Embakasi West MP on a TNA ticket beating ODM’s Brian Weke after garnering 40,606 votes against his 35,333.

In 2017, he was re-elected under the Jubilee Party, beating Tom Agimba of ODM with 47,848 votes, against Agimba’s 30,983 votes.

Following his failed re election bid in 2022, Theuri thanked the people of Embakasi west noting that services to the people was key and he called on the electorate to support the current MP even as he plans for a come back.

Theuri has been on record,  keeping on touch with the electorate in the larger Embakasi West while at the we time, ensuring that he keeps working for the people in his personal capacity.

Born and raised in Umoja’s Eastlands estate, Theuri was  elected  as Umoja One councillor in 2007 before moving up to parliament in 2013.
